Ohio's Leash Laws. Ohio Revised Code Section 955.22 outlines the Ohio dog leash laws. It requires dogs to be on a leash no longer than six feet long in public places unless otherwise specified. If a dog is on someone else's property, it must be on a leash regardless of whether the owner allows it.

This can vary greatly, depending on the person asked; however, failure to provide adequate food, water, or shelter is neglect. The use of physical force to cause injury to an animal is abuse. And neglect or abuse constitutes cruelty to animals, which is illegal in Ohio.

Owner shall have animal securely leashed or under "Direct Control" at all times. Direct Control means the animal will come, sit and stay on command from the owner. Direct Control is part of Columbus City Code 2327.11, and violation of this code is a 3rd degree misdemeanor.
Failing to register a dog you own, keep, or harbor is an unclassified misdemeanor with the following penalties: First Offense: Fine no less than $25.00 and no more than $75.00. Second Offense: Fine no less than $75.00 and no more than $250.00 and up to 30 days in jail.
